§ 356. Penalty for sale of donated food
Any person or any employee of or volunteer for a charitable or religious organization who sells, or offers to sell, for profit, food that such person knows to be donated pursuant to this act commits a misdemeanor of the third degree. The assessment of a nominal fee by the charitable or religious organization shall not be considered a sale.

Credits

1981, July 10, P.L. 234, No. 76, § 6, effective in 60 days.
